Biography
Annette Poivre (24 June 1917 – 2 June 1988) was a French stage and film actress. She was married to the actor Raymond Bussières with whom she sometimes co-starred. Poivre was noted for her comic performances. Source: Article "Annette Poivre" from Wikipedia in English, licensed under CC-BY-SA 3.0.
